This article analyzes Generative Engine Optimization (GEO), debunking the misconception that it's merely content stacking. It introduces expert Yu Lei's 'Two Cores + Four Drives' methodology, emphasizing humanized GEO and content cross-validation as cores, supported by E-E-A-T principles, structured content, SEO keyword rules, and precise data citation. Case studies demonstrate its effectiveness in boosting AI search visibility and customer acquisition across industries like finance, healthcare, and education.
